Opinion
Order affirmed, without costs; no opinion.
Concur: Loughran, Finch, Rippey, Sears, Lewis and Conway, JJ. Lehman, Ch. J., dissents on the ground that the cases which hold that there can be no casting vote unless there be a tie are based upon statutes which specifically so provide. In this case it appears from a reading of the statute that the Mayor has a casting vote whenever his vote would be a vote that turns the scab (Cf. Oxford Dictionary).
